The short version
Lakeville is a city of 879 people in Indiana. Four-year degrees are less common here than nationally, at 10% of adults. The population has risen by half since 2000, adding 312 people. Owners hold 44% of the housing stock. The typical home is worth $88,900. The poverty rate is 24.6%, above the 12.8% national rate.

Frequently asked
How many people live in Lakeville, Indiana? Lakeville, Indiana has about 879 residents according to the 2020 American Community Survey.
What is the median household income in Lakeville, Indiana? The typical household in Lakeville, Indiana earns about $39,605 a year. Half of households make more than that, and half make less.
Is Lakeville, Indiana expensive? In Lakeville, Indiana, the median home is worth about $88,900, and the typical rent is about $770 a month.
How educated are people in Lakeville, Indiana? About 10.0% of adults age 25 and over in Lakeville, Indiana h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
What is the poverty rate in Lakeville, Indiana? About 24.6% of people in Lakeville, Indiana live below the federal poverty line.
Has Lakeville, Indiana grown since 1990? Yes, Lakeville, Indiana has grown since 1990. The population has added about 229 residents, a change of about 35 percent over that period.
